FOLLOWING the successful launch of the 138th Malasakit Center in the capital town of Jolo, the team of Sen. Christopher Lawrence "Bong" Go conducted a series of relief efforts for a total of 3,053 beneficiaries, mainly composed of market vendors and Tricycle Operators and Drivers Association members, in Maimbung, Sulu on September 4 and 5.
Go, chairman of the Senate Committee on Health and Demography, reiterated in his video message the importance of looking after one's health and well-being, especially during a national health crisis as he encouraged the essential workers to seek medical assistance when needed in any of the two Malasakit Centers in the province.
